Have you ever heard the saying “a lazy man works twice”? It’s ironic, but we often end up doing twice the work by trying to take shortcuts in life.

When it comes to fitness, dieting is number one on the shortcut list. Most people think you should be able to physically “work” the weight off without dieting. No matter how much I encourage people to work as hard on their eating as they do in the gym; some people just have to learn the hard way.

This experience is most obvious during intense training like our Boot Camp program. Most of our boot campers have never worked as hard as they do during Boot Camp. When you’re working that hard you expect results - and when you don’t get them you are devastated. Besides, you put in the same energy as the girl next to you who seems to be dropping weight by the minute. The difference is you are trying a shortcut and your shortcut isn’t working.

So, what do you do now? It’s time to turn things around and take the road to success. The first step is to forgive yourself. It’s so easy to beat yourself up and feel like a failure, but you’re only a failure if you give up. Almost all of our weight loss success stories were once so-called failures – but they were failures who learned from their mistakes and became victorious.

This brings me to the next step, which is to learn from your mistakes. Not only can you learn from your own mistakes but you can learn from other people’s successes. The key is applying what you’ve learned for your benefit.

Next, even if you haven’t lost weight from exercise alone, you’re probably in better shape now. Use your new physical condition to work for you. The only difference is now you are going to work just as hard on both your diet and your exercise.

Lastly, look at past failures as the beginning and not the end. Once you have learned a lesson, you get to start fresh with the new information you have obtained. This is far from the end - this could be the beginning of your personal success story.

When it comes to fitness, short cuts will get you nowhere. Besides, sometimes the long way is the only way to some of the best destinations.
